Well, here's the freshman stats for the other 5:
McCants: 17ppg, 4.6 rpg
Felton: 12.6 ppg, 6.7 apg
May: 11.4 ppg, 8.1 rpg
Lawson: 10.2 ppg, 5.6 apg
Ellington: 11.7 ppg, 2.9 rpg
All of them are pretty good, so I'm not sure I see your point.

Talent wise UNC will be very strong, but same could be said last year.
Last year UNC lacked upperclassmen and a proven PG. Same can be said this year, even less with Graves and Knox the only seniors versus Deon and 5th year guy Ginyard, but a little stronger among juniors with Zeller having two injury shortened seasons under hsi belt plus Drew II and Watts versus jsut Graves last year. Marshall is added to mix with Drew II and strickland but none seem final four caliber PGs.
Lack of seniors affects defense which is not a UNC point of emphasis relative to run, run, run, but who steps into the Ginyard stopper role is an open question. It could be Barnes but can't keep putting HB's name of every UNC question mark, outside shot, defensive stopper, leader, go to guy etc.
UNC only had Graves as outside threat last year but this year has Graves, and Barnes and possibly Bullock can hit it consistently his first year, plus some guys might improve over summer.
UNC had way more injuries than is normal and expect this year that will be much lower.
I see UNC and Duke as usual as two of top teams in ACC with UNC possibly making sweet 16 and then anything can happen.
